Oberlo is a popular platform used for dropshipping, particularly with Shopify stores. Here are some pros and cons associated with using Oberlo:

Pros:

1. **Easy Integration**: Oberlo seamlessly integrates with Shopify, making it easy for users to set up a dropshipping business without much technical knowledge.

2. **Large Product Selection**: Oberlo offers access to a vast catalog of products from suppliers all over the world, giving users plenty of options to choose from and enabling them to find products that suit their niche.

3. **Automatic Order Fulfillment**: Orders placed through Shopify are automatically fulfilled by Oberlo, reducing the manual workload for the store owner. This automation saves time and streamlines the fulfillment process.

4. **Price Monitoring and Updates**: Oberlo constantly monitors product prices and stock levels, ensuring that users have access to accurate and up-to-date information. This helps prevent selling products that are out of stock or no longer profitable.

5. **Inventory Management**: Oberlo provides tools for managing inventory levels, making it easier for users to track stock levels and avoid selling products that are out of stock.

Cons:

1. **Dependency on AliExpress**: Most suppliers on Oberlo are from AliExpress, which may not always offer the fastest shipping times or the highest quality products. This can lead to longer shipping times and potential quality issues, affecting customer satisfaction.

2. **High Competition**: Since Oberlo is widely used, many dropshippers may be selling the same products, leading to high competition and potentially lower profit margins.

3. **Limited Customization**: While Oberlo simplifies the dropshipping process, it also limits customization options for products. Users may have less control over product branding, packaging, and other aspects of the customer experience.

4. **Product Quality Control**: Since users don't physically handle the products they sell, ensuring product quality can be challenging. There's a risk of receiving negative feedback or returns if the product quality doesn't meet customer expectations.

5. **Subscription Costs**: While Oberlo offers a free plan with limited features, users may need to upgrade to a paid plan to access advanced features and scale their businesses. Subscription costs can add up over time, especially for larger businesses.

Overall, Oberlo can be a valuable tool for entrepreneurs looking to start a dropshipping business quickly and easily. However, it's essential to weigh the pros and cons carefully and consider whether Oberlo is the right fit for your business needs and goals.
